Sworn to silence : or, Aline Rodney's secret by Mrs. Alex. McVeigh Miller
"Sworn to silence" by Mrs. Alex. McVeigh Miller is a novel written in the late 19th century. It blends gothic mystery and romantic melodrama around Aline Rodney, a high-spirited girl who stumbles into the dangerous secrets of her enigmatic neighbor, Oran Delaney, and his “haunted” mansion. The story promises a tale of secrecy, peril, and forbidden sympathy as a community searches while the heroine is compelled toward an oath that may bind
her future. The opening of the novel finds Aline punished and locked in her room while her family goes to a picnic; in a fit of pique she tosses a book out the window, accidentally striking their aloof neighbor, Oran Delaney. He coaxes her down a ladder to gather flowers and then to lunch in his grand, shuttered house, where terrifying shrieks erupt and a grotesque, veiled figure in a torn bridal gown attacks and stabs her. Aline awakens in a lavish blue room under a nurse’s care, while Delaney—also wounded—refuses to contact her family, insists she remain hidden until healed, and hints she must be sworn to silence before release. As he brings flowers and reads to calm her, the household next door descends into panic: searches spread, her mother falls ill, and the town is gripped by the mystery. A visiting physician, Dr. Anthony, then tells Aline’s sister Effie how a masked stranger abducted him to a grand house to treat a beautiful, unconscious girl who matches Aline’s description, deepening the sense that the truth lies very near yet out of reach.
